Beautiful, manufactured home built in 2019, offering 2 bedrooms and 2 bathrooms, located in the heart of Orlando and close to major roads, grocery stores, shopping centers, and entertainment. This home offers convenience and comfort in a prime Central Florida location. Located at Silver Star, a 55 plus community on monthly leased land, this home provides a peaceful lifestyle with great amenities and easy access to everything you need. As you arrive, you will find a spacious carport for two cars and a screened in room, perfect for relaxing and enjoying the beautiful Central Florida sunsets. Inside, the home features an open concept layout with a modern kitchen equipped with stainless steel appliances and a large island, ideal for enjoying meals with friends and family. The home offers vinyl flooring throughout and elegant crown molding, giving it a stylish and updated look. The large master bedroom includes a walk in shower and a spacious closet, providing comfort and privacy. This home is in excellent condition and ready to move in.
